ROKADI to Supply Fuel Interface Rings to GA-ASI

SAN DIEGO.  Republic of Korea-based ROKADI has signed a Purchase Order to supply General Atomics Aeronautical Systems, Inc. (GA-ASI) with fuel interface rings for GA-ASI’s new MQ-9B SkyGuardian®/SeaGuardian® Unmanned Aircraft Systems. The signing took place during the Global Industrial Cooperation Association (GICA) 2023 Autumn Conference in Seoul, South Korea on October 13, 2023.

“We’re excited to be working with ROKADI,” said Jaime Walters, vice president of International Strategic Development at GA-ASI. “Using ROKADI’s product is a testament to the confidence GA-ASI has in the Korean industry capability.”

On June 23, 2023, ROKADI completed First Article Inspection of the Interface Fuel Rings. ROKADI designs, engineers, and manufactures large and complex contoured aerostructure components for the aviation industry.

Jisang Park, executive vice president at ROKADI, said: “We are delighted that ROKADI’s capabilities have been approved by GA-ASI. We hope to expand and deepen our relationship with GA-ASI through this opportunity.”

GA-ASI is manufacturer of UAS operated by the U.S. and international partners as an intelligence-gathering and strike-capable asset. GA-ASI has delivered more than 1,000 unmanned aircraft since its founding in 1992 and its aircraft have flown over 8 million hours. GA-ASI’s newest and most advanced aircraft, the MQ-9B SkyGuardian and SeaGuardian, are tailored to meet the multi-domain and multi-environmental needs of its customers.
